IN RE KIRSH

No. 91-55701.

973 F.2d 1454 (1992)

In re Ronald KIRSH; In re Paula Kirsh, Debtors. EUGENE PARKS LAW CORPORATION DEFINED BENEFIT PENSION PLAN,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. Ronald KIRSH; Paula Kirsh, Defendants-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als, Ninth Circuit.

Decided August 31, 1992.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Gary Brown, Century City, Cal., for plaintiff-appellant.

James M. Leonard, Leonard & Zeitsoff, Los Angeles, Cal., for defendants-appellees.

Before FARRIS, WIGGINS and FERNANDEZ, Circuit Judges.


PER CURIAM:

Ronald and Paula Kirsh (the Kirshes) filed for bankruptcy, and the Eugene Parks Deferred Benefit Pension Plan (the Plan) asked that the Kirshes' debt to it be found nondischargeable pursuant to 11 U.S.C. § 523(a)(2)(A). The bankruptcy court denied that request because it found that the Plan had not relied on the Kirshes' false representations. The district court affirmed the bankruptcy court. We affirm.
